Abstract
A solid-state image pickup device consists of a plurality of pixels arranged in a matrix for outputting an image signal corresponding to the received light intensity. The solid-state image pickup device includes: reset switches (13,23) for opening/closing between a VDDCELL that repeatedly and cyclically outputs a high potential and a low potential and an electric charge holding section in each pixel; reset signal lines (97,98) connected to pixels of the same row; a row scan circuit (80) for successively selecting rows, always giving Hi impedance or Lo impedance to the reset signal of the selected row and Hi impedance to the reset signal lines of the non-selected row; and an ALLRS circuit 94 for giving the Lo potential to the reset line of the non-selected row before and after the rise of VDCELL from a low potential to high potential. Thus, the solid-state image pickup device can reduce its size and increase its operation speed while suppressing lowering of the dynamic range.
